We detect you are using an unsupported browser. For the best experience, please visit the site using Chrome, Firefox, Safari, or Edge. X
Maximize Your Experience: Reap the Personalized Advantages by Completing Your Profile to Its Fullest! Update Here
Stay in the loop with the latest from Microchip! Update your profile while you are at it. Update Here
Complete your profile to access more resources.Update Here!
Item Qty
Your cart is empty.

Begin Prototyping With PolarFire SoC FPGAs


We have multiple target plaforms based on PolarFire SoC FPGAs. To get started, follow the steps below:

  1. Select a target platform; we have both proprietary evaluation platforms and production-ready devices from our ecosystem partners.
  2. Download the reference material.
  3. Receive support by joining GitHub discussions or contacting our support team.

PolarFire® SoC Icicle Kit

The PolarFire SoC Icicle Kit runs Linux® out of the box and evaluates the microprocessor (MPU) subsystem, FPGA fabric, PCIe®, Gigabit Ethernet, CAN, USB and more.

PolarFire® SoC Video Kit 

The PolarFire SoC Video Kit is a full-featured embedded vision development platform targeting secure, reliable and power-efficient vision applications at the edge, including our VectorBlox™ Accelerator SDK and Neural Network IP, and Industrial IoT (IIoT) and automation applications.

PolarFire® SoC Discovery Kit

The PolarFire SoC Discovery Kit is a low-cost, open-source development kit powered by a quad-core, RISC-V application-class processor. This device supports Linux® and real-time applications, a rich set of peripherals and 95K low-power, high-performance FPGA logic elements.

PolarFire® SoC Renode Model

Renode provides a simulation model for the PolarFire SoC and Mi-V soft CPUs that you can use to debug firmware. Renode is bundled with the SoftConsole development environment.

PolarFire SoC Icicle Kit Design Resources


Category Description With Links
Quick Start Guide PolarFire® SoC Icicle Kit Quick Start Guide
Reference Design Icicle Kit Reference Design
Software Development Tools for PolarFire SoC Icicle Kit:
PolarFire SoC MSS Configurator
Libero® SoC Design Suite 2022.3 or later
Eclipse-Based Integrated Development Environment (IDE)
Github Links GitHub Repository
Yocto
Buildroot
MPFS User Guide
Hart Software Services (HSS) Code
Ubuntu Port
Licensing A Libero Design Suite Silver license is required to evaluate your designs with the PolarFire SoC Video Kit. It is free and valid for one year. It supports single-language simulation with programming and debugging features.
Generate your free Silver license
Mi-V Ecosystem Third-Party Partner Ecosystem
Documentation User Guides and Documentation for PolarFire SoC

PolarFire SoC Video Kit Design Resources


Category Description With Links
Solutions Smart Embedded Vision
Quick Start Guide PolarFire® SoC Video Kit Quick Start Guide
Reference Design Video Kit Reference Design
H.264 Reference Design
Software Development Tools for PolarFire SoC Video Kit:
PolarFire SoC MSS Configurator
Libero® SoC Design Suite 2022.3 or Later
Eclipse-Based Integrated Development Environment (IDE)
Github Links GitHub Repository
Pre-Built Job File
Yocto
Buildroot
Pre-Built Yocto (WIC) Image
H.264 Demo Guide
MPFS User Guide
Hart Software Services (HSS) Code
Licensing: A Libero Design Suite Silver license is required to evaluate your designs with the PolarFire SoC Video Kit. It is free and valid for one year. It supports single-language simulation with programming and debugging features.
Generate your free Silver license
Mi-V Ecosystem Third-Party Partner Ecosystem
Documentation User Guides and Documentation for PolarFire SoC

PolarFire SoC Renode Model Design Resources


Reference Material Description
Renode Webinar Series View videos on getting started and register for our upcoming Renode webinar series
SoftConsole Release Notes SoftConsole and Renode installation instructions and release notes
Renode Complete documentation on Renode
SoftConsole SoftConsole software and documentation

Support


GitHub Discussions

Try our discussions forum on our GitHub page. Browse the available database of questions and answers, post your questions and support others in the discussions. 

Mi-V Partner Information 

Please contact partners directly for more information.

Technical Support

Visit our technical support portal for assistance with your PolarFire SoC FPGA-based design.

Introduction to PolarFire SoC Icicle Kit

We introduced the development kit for the industry’s first RISC-V-based SoC FPGA, the PolarFire SoC Icicle Kit. The Icicle Kit centers around a 254K Logic Element (LE) PolarFire SoC FPGA and includes a PCIe® root port, mikroBUS™ expansion, dual Gigabit Ethernet, USB-OTG, CAN bus, Raspberry Pi® header, JTAG and SD™ card interfaces, which provide a full-featured platform for development.

PolarFire SoC FPGAs deliver up to 50% lower total power than competing devices. The Icicle Kit for PolarFire SoC FPGAs is well suited for smart embedded imaging, IoT, industrial automation, defense, automotive and communication applications.